Special Witnesses of Christ

The First Presidency and the Quorum of the Twelve Apostles each bear their personal testimony about the Savior and Redeemer of the World.

  • Jesus Christ Ushered in the Restoration

    What have Heavenly Father and Jesus Christ done to bless us today? What role did the Savior play in restoring the gospel to the earth? From Palmyra, New York, President Thomas S. Monson answers those questions.
  • Temples Reflect the Savior’s Love for Us

    How do temples remind us of the Savior’s love? What priesthood keys enable temple work to be done today? From the steps of the Salt Lake Temple, President Henry B. Eyring bears testimony that the Savior’s love for us and our love for Him is reflected in the temple.
  • Jesus Christ Lives Today


    What can bring peace to the world? How can we find happiness in this life? Standing at the feet of a statue portraying the Savior, President Dieter F. Uchtdorf answers those questions.
  • The Savior Cares Deeply about Family History and Redeeming the Dead

    Why are family history work and the redemption of the dead so important? What key role does the Savior play in these profoundly important efforts?  Speaking from the chapel at  the Kirtland Temple, President Boyd K. Packer answers those questions.
  • Joy—for Us and Others—Comes by Following the Savior

    Does our obedience to the Savior’s law and commandments make a difference to others? How can we find happiness through this obedience? Elder L. Tom Perry answers those questions by sharing an experience he had as a young man.
